What the Court ordered
In view of the foregoing, this appeal is allowed and the impugned order of the Designate of the Chief Justice appointing an Arbitrator is set aside.

From the headnote
Arbitration and Conciliation Act, 1996: c ss. 8(1), (3), 11 and 15(2) - Appointment of arbitrator pending appeal filed against dismissal of suit under Or. 7, r. 11 CPC read withs. 8(1) of the Act- HELD: An application uls 11 or s. 15(2) of the Act, for appointment of an arbitrator, will not be barred by pendency of an application uls 8 in any suit, 0 nor will the Designate of the Chief Justice be precluded from considering and disposing of an application uls 11 or s. 15(2) - Thus, if an arbitrator is appointed by the Designate of the Chief Justice u/s 11, nothing prevents the arbitrator from
